What makes acne hormonal?
All acne has some hormonal component — androgens (testosterone and related hormones) stimulate sebaceous glands to produce sebum, which contributes to the follicular environment that leads to breakouts. But adult hormonal acne in women refers to a specific pattern driven by cyclical or elevated androgen activity that produces a characteristic presentation.
The key drivers:
Androgenic stimulation of sebaceous glands. Testosterone and dihydrotestosterone (DHT) bind to receptors in sebaceous glands and increase sebum production. Women with higher androgen sensitivity — even without elevated androgen levels on blood tests — experience more androgenic stimulation to their skin's oil glands.
Cyclical hormonal fluctuations. In the days before menstruation, estrogen and progesterone drop while androgen levels remain relatively constant. This relative androgenic dominance triggers increased sebum production and inflammation in the follicle — producing the classic pre-period flare.
Perimenopausal hormonal shifts. As estrogen declines during perimenopause, androgen activity becomes relatively more dominant. Many women experience new or worsened acne in their 40s for precisely this reason.
Stress hormones. Cortisol increases androgen production. Chronic stress is a significant hormonal acne trigger that many people underestimate.
The hormonal acne pattern
Hormonal acne has a recognisable presentation that distinguishes it from other acne types:
Location. Primarily the lower face — jawline, chin, around the mouth, and sometimes the neck. This is where sebaceous glands have the highest androgen receptor density.
Timing. Flares correlate with the menstrual cycle — typically worsening in the week before menstruation and improving after.
Type of lesions. Often deep, cystic, or nodular — the kind that sit under the skin for weeks rather than coming to a head quickly. These are driven by deep follicular inflammation rather than surface congestion.
Persistence. Hormonal acne in adults tends to be chronic rather than resolving with age the way teenage acne often does. Without addressing the underlying hormonal driver, breakouts continue indefinitely.
Why OTC treatments underperform for hormonal acne
Most OTC acne products target surface congestion — salicylic acid face washes, benzoyl peroxide spot treatments, retinol serums. These can help with some acne presentations, but hormonal acne is driven at a level these products don't reach.
They don't address sebaceous gland activity. Hormonal acne is fundamentally about excess androgen-driven sebum production. Nothing available OTC meaningfully reduces androgenic stimulation of the sebaceous glands.
They don't control deep follicular inflammation. Cystic and nodular lesions require prescription-strength anti-inflammatory and antibacterial actives to resolve faster and prevent scarring.
They don't address the cyclical pattern. OTC products are applied consistently but don't adapt to the hormonal fluctuations driving periodic flares.

Oral options
In more severe cases, or where topical treatment alone isn't sufficient, oral treatments may be appropriate — oral contraceptives that reduce androgenic activity, spironolactone (an androgen blocker increasingly used for hormonal acne), or oral antibiotics short-term. Managing hormonal acne through the cycle
A useful clinical strategy for cyclical hormonal acne is targeted intervention in the pre-menstrual window — increasing application frequency of active treatment or adding a targeted spot treatment in the 5–7 days before menstruation when androgen-driven flares are most likely. General lifestyle factors that reduce androgenic stimulation: stress management (cortisol reduction), limiting high-glycaemic foods (which trigger insulin and androgen spikes), and adequate sleep (which regulates cortisol). These don't replace prescription treatment but support it.
